Green Infrastructure in the Gauteng City-Region

This video is an introduction to the idea of green infrastructure as an approach for the Gauteng City-Region to improve the environment but also the economy and quality of life of the city-region.

The last few years have seen a significant uptick in research interest and policy concern over the sustainability of the development path we are on. For example there is a growing awareness of the probable development impacts of climate change and variability (Gauteng is likely to see increased disaster vulnerability and growing water scarcity in the years ahead).

The Gauteng City-Region Observatory (GCRO) is a partnership between the University of Johannesburg (UJ), the University of the Witwatersrand, Johannesburg (Wits) and the Gauteng Provincial Government (GPG), with local government in Gauteng also represented on the GCRO Board.
